Essential Guide to SPF and DKIM: Safeguard Your Email Campaigns Immediately
Coincidentally, you might not be aware of the potential risks that lurk within your email campaigns. Your carefully crafted messages could be falling victim to spam filters or even worse, phishing attempts.
But fear not, because in this essential guide to SPF and DKIM, you'll discover the key to safeguarding your email campaigns immediately. By implementing these essential email authentication methods, you'll not only enhance the security of your emails, but also boost your deliverability and protect your sender reputation.
So, if you're ready to take control of your email campaigns and ensure their success, keep reading to learn everything you need to know about SPF and DKIM.
Key Takeaways
- SPF and DKIM are essential email authentication protocols that protect domain reputation and prevent email spoofing.
- Implementing SPF and DKIM improves email deliverability and increases the chances of emails being delivered to the inbox.
- SPF verifies the sender's authorization by checking the IP address, while DKIM digitally signs outgoing emails to prove authenticity.
- SPF and DKIM authentication play a crucial role in email deliverability and spam filtering, impacting whether emails are delivered to the inbox or marked as spam.
What Is SPF and Why Is It Important?
SPF, which stands for Sender Policy Framework, is an essential email authentication protocol that plays a crucial role in safeguarding your email campaigns. Implementing SPF can be challenging due to various factors.
One of the challenges is understanding the technical aspects of SPF and its configuration. SPF requires modifying your DNS records and ensuring that they're properly set up to authorize the IP addresses allowed to send emails on behalf of your domain. This can be complex for individuals without technical expertise.
Another challenge in SPF implementation is dealing with third-party services. If you use external email service providers, they may send emails on your behalf using their own servers. In this case, you need to ensure that their IP addresses are included in your SPF record to avoid email rejections. Coordination and communication with these providers are essential to ensure successful SPF implementation.
Despite the challenges, SPF is of utmost importance for email authentication. It helps prevent email spoofing and protects your domain's reputation. By implementing SPF, you can ensure that only authorized servers send emails on behalf of your domain, reducing the risk of phishing attacks and improving email deliverability.
Understanding the Role of DKIM in Email Security
To further strengthen your email security, it is essential to understand the role of DKIM (DomainKeys Identified Mail) and its significance in protecting your email campaigns. DKIM is an email authentication method that allows the recipient to verify that the email they received is from the domain it claims to be from and that it has not been tampered with during transit. By digitally signing your emails with DKIM, you provide a cryptographic proof of authenticity, ensuring that your messages are not altered or spoofed.
Implementing DKIM offers several advantages for email security. First, it helps prevent email spoofing and phishing attacks, as the recipient can verify the email's origin. Second, DKIM protects your brand reputation by ensuring that your emails are not forged or modified by unauthorized parties. Third, it improves email deliverability, as reputable email providers often check for DKIM signatures to determine the legitimacy of incoming emails. Finally, DKIM enhances overall email security by providing an additional layer of protection against email-based threats.
Here is a table summarizing the role of DKIM in email authentication and its advantages for email security:
Role of DKIM in Email Authentication | Advantages of Implementing DKIM for Email Security |
---|---|
Verifies the authenticity of emails | Prevents email spoofing and phishing attacks |
Ensures emails are not tampered with | Protects brand reputation |
Improves email deliverability | Enhances overall email security |
The Benefits of Implementing SPF and DKIM for Your Email Campaigns
Implementing SPF and DKIM for your email campaigns offers a range of benefits for ensuring the security and authenticity of your messages. By implementing these authentication methods, you can greatly enhance the overall reputation of your email campaigns.
One of the key benefits of implementing SPF and DKIM is the improved email deliverability. With SPF, you can specify the authorized mail servers for your domain, preventing spammers from sending emails on your behalf. This helps in protecting your domain's reputation and increasing the chances of your emails reaching the recipients' inboxes.
DKIM, on the other hand, adds a digital signature to your emails, verifying their authenticity. This not only helps in preventing email forgery but also enhances your email's reputation. Email providers, such as Gmail and Yahoo, often check for DKIM signatures and use them as a factor in determining the legitimacy of the emails.
Step-By-Step Guide to Setting up SPF for Your Domain
Setting up SPF for your domain is a crucial step in safeguarding your email campaigns.
To begin, you need to create an SPF record that specifies which IP addresses are authorized to send emails on behalf of your domain.
Once the record is created, you'll then need to configure your DNS settings to include this SPF record.
SPF Record Creation
Ensure the security and authenticity of your email campaigns by following these step-by-step instructions to create an SPF record for your domain.
An SPF (Sender Policy Framework) record is a DNS (Domain Name System) record that identifies which IP addresses are allowed to send emails on behalf of your domain.
To create an SPF record, you need to add a TXT record to your domain's DNS settings. The SPF record format consists of a set of directives that specify the authorized IP addresses or hostnames for sending emails from your domain.
After creating the SPF record, it's important to test it using SPF record testing tools to ensure its accuracy and effectiveness in preventing email spoofing.
DNS Configuration
To continue securing and authenticating your email campaigns, it's essential to configure the DNS settings for your domain, specifically focusing on setting up SPF (Sender Policy Framework).
DNS configuration involves making changes to the DNS records of your domain to include the necessary SPF information. First, access the DNS management console provided by your domain registrar or hosting provider.
Locate the DNS settings for your domain and add a new TXT record. In the value field, enter the SPF record, which specifies the authorized senders for your domain.
Save the changes and wait for the DNS propagation to complete.
To troubleshoot DNS configuration issues, ensure that the SPF record is correctly formatted, and double-check the spelling and syntax. Use online SPF validation tools to verify the record's accuracy.
How to Generate and Configure DKIM Signatures for Your Emails
To generate and configure DKIM signatures for your emails, follow these comprehensive steps to ensure the security and authenticity of your email campaigns.
First, you need to generate DKIM keys. These keys consist of a private key and a public key. The private key is kept secret and is used to sign your outgoing emails, while the public key is published in your DNS records for verification purposes.
Next, you'll need to configure DKIM signatures in your email server or email service provider. This involves adding the public key to your DNS records and configuring your email server to sign outgoing emails with the private key.
Here's a step-by-step guide to generating and configuring DKIM signatures:
Step | Description |
---|---|
1. | Generate DKIM keys by using a DKIM key generator tool or your email service provider's DKIM key generation feature. |
2. | Copy the public key generated by the tool or service. |
3. | Add the public key to your DNS records as a TXT record. |
4. | Configure your email server or email service provider to sign outgoing emails with the private key. |
5. | Test your DKIM configuration by sending a test email and checking the email headers for the presence of the DKIM signature. |
6. | Monitor your DKIM signatures regularly to ensure they are properly configured and functioning correctly. |
Common Mistakes to Avoid When Implementing SPF and DKIM
When implementing SPF and DKIM, it's important to be aware of common errors that can occur.
One common mistake in SPF implementation isn't properly configuring the DNS records, resulting in emails being marked as spam.
Another pitfall to avoid with DKIM is failing to regularly rotate the private key, which can compromise the security of your email campaigns.
Common Errors in SPF
One common mistake to avoid when implementing SPF and DKIM is neglecting to thoroughly test the configuration before launching your email campaign. This oversight can lead to issues with email deliverability and potentially damage your sender reputation.
To ensure a successful implementation of SPF, keep in mind these common errors:
- Failing to include all relevant sending sources in the SPF record, resulting in email authentication failures.
- Forgetting to update the SPF record when making changes to your sending infrastructure, causing SPF failures.
- Incorrectly configuring the SPF record by using the wrong syntax or not including the necessary components, leading to authentication issues.
Pitfalls of DKIM
Common mistakes can lead to authentication failures and compromise the effectiveness of DKIM in safeguarding your email campaigns. To ensure the successful implementation of DKIM, it is crucial to be aware of the common pitfalls and have troubleshooting techniques in place. Here are a few common mistakes to avoid when implementing DKIM:
Common Pitfalls | Troubleshooting Techniques |
---|---|
Incorrect key length | Verify that the key length meets the required specifications. |
Incorrect DNS record setup | Double-check the DNS records for accuracy and make any necessary corrections. |
Key rotation issues | Regularly update and rotate the DKIM keys to maintain security and prevent any potential compromises. |
Mismatched signatures | Ensure that the signing and verification processes are aligned, and the signatures match accurately. |
Inconsistent key management | Establish a proper key management system to manage and update keys effectively. |
Best Practices for Maintaining SPF and DKIM Records
To effectively maintain SPF and DKIM records, it's crucial to follow best practices. By implementing these guidelines, you can ensure the integrity and deliverability of your email campaigns.
Here are three essential best practices for maintaining SPF and DKIM records:
- Regularly review and update your SPF and DKIM records: Keep track of any changes to your email infrastructure, such as adding new email servers or changing email service providers. Regularly review and update your SPF and DKIM records to include all authorized senders and domains.
- Test your SPF and DKIM configurations: Regularly test the effectiveness of your SPF and DKIM configurations to ensure they're set up correctly and functioning as intended. Use online tools and email authentication checkers to verify that your records pass authentication checks.
- Monitor and troubleshoot SPF and DKIM issues: Stay vigilant by monitoring your email delivery and authentication logs for any SPF or DKIM authentication failures. Investigate and resolve any issues promptly to prevent email deliverability problems.
How SPF and DKIM Work Together to Protect Your Email Reputation
SPF and DKIM work together seamlessly to safeguard your email reputation, ensuring that your messages are authenticated and delivered successfully. By implementing both of these authentication mechanisms, you can significantly improve your email deliverability and protect your brand's reputation.
SPF (Sender Policy Framework) verifies that the sender of an email is authorized to send messages on behalf of a specific domain. It works by checking the IP address of the sending server against the list of authorized IP addresses in the domain's DNS records. If the IP address matches, SPF authentication passes, and the email is considered legitimate. On the other hand, if the IP address doesn't match, SPF authentication fails, and the email is more likely to be flagged as spam.
DKIM (DomainKeys Identified Mail) adds an additional layer of authentication by digitally signing outgoing emails. It uses public-key cryptography to create a digital signature that proves the authenticity of the email. When the receiving server receives the email, it verifies the DKIM signature by using the public key retrieved from the domain's DNS records. If the signature is valid, DKIM authentication passes, and the email is considered legitimate. If the signature is invalid or missing, DKIM authentication fails, and the email is more likely to be marked as suspicious or fraudulent.
Combining SPF and DKIM authentication provides a robust framework for verifying the authenticity of your emails. By properly configuring SPF and DKIM records, you can significantly reduce the chances of your messages being marked as spam or phishing attempts. This, in turn, improves your email deliverability and ensures that your legitimate emails reach your recipients' inboxes.
To help illustrate the impact of SPF and DKIM on email deliverability, consider the following table:
Scenario | SPF Authentication | DKIM Authentication | Result |
---|---|---|---|
Email passes SPF and DKIM authentication | Pass | Pass | Email delivered to the inbox |
Email fails SPF or DKIM authentication | Fail | Pass or Fail | Email may be marked as spam |
Email passes SPF authentication but fails DKIM authentication | Pass | Fail | Email may be marked as suspicious |
Email fails SPF authentication but passes DKIM authentication | Fail | Pass | Email may be marked as suspicious |
Email fails both SPF and DKIM authentication | Fail | Fail | Email likely to be marked as spam |
Understanding how SPF and DKIM authenticate emails and their impact on email deliverability is crucial for ensuring the successful delivery of your email campaigns. By implementing and maintaining SPF and DKIM records correctly, you can enhance your email reputation, increase deliverability rates, and build trust with your recipients.
Monitoring and Troubleshooting SPF and DKIM Issues
Monitoring and troubleshooting issues with SPF and DKIM authentication is essential for ensuring the effectiveness and reliability of your email campaigns. By using monitoring tools and troubleshooting techniques, you can identify and resolve any problems that may arise.
Here are three important steps to help you effectively monitor and troubleshoot SPF and DKIM issues:
- Utilize monitoring tools: There are various monitoring tools available that can help you track the status of your SPF and DKIM records. These tools provide real-time monitoring and alert you if any issues are detected. They can also provide valuable insights into the authentication status of your email campaigns.
- Regularly check authentication results: It's important to regularly check the authentication results of your emails. This involves reviewing the SPF and DKIM headers of your outgoing emails to ensure they're properly authenticated. By monitoring these results, you can quickly identify any discrepancies or failures in the authentication process.
- Use troubleshooting techniques: When troubleshooting SPF and DKIM issues, it's important to start by reviewing your DNS records and ensuring they're correctly configured. You can also check if your email service provider supports SPF and DKIM authentication and if the records are properly set up in their system. Additionally, reviewing email headers and analyzing delivery reports can help identify any potential issues.
Future-Proofing Your Email Campaigns With SPF and DKIM
To future-proof your email campaigns with SPF and DKIM, you need to focus on two key areas: improved email deliverability and preventing email spoofing.
By implementing SPF (Sender Policy Framework) and DKIM (DomainKeys Identified Mail), you can ensure that your emails are authenticated and trusted by receiving mail servers. This will help increase the chances of your emails reaching the inbox and not getting flagged as spam.
Additionally, it will also protect your brand reputation by preventing unauthorized individuals from sending emails on behalf of your domain.
Improved Email Deliverability
Ensure the future-proofing of your email campaigns by implementing SPF and DKIM to enhance email deliverability. By improving email authentication and preventing phishing attacks, you can significantly boost the success of your email marketing efforts.
Here are three key benefits of implementing SPF and DKIM:
- Increased email deliverability: SPF (Sender Policy Framework) allows you to specify which servers are authorized to send emails on your behalf, reducing the chances of your emails being flagged as spam or rejected by recipient servers.
- Enhanced email reputation: DKIM (DomainKeys Identified Mail) adds a digital signature to your outgoing emails, verifying that they weren't tampered with during transit. This helps build trust and improves your email sender reputation.
- Protection against phishing attacks: SPF and DKIM help prevent spammers from impersonating your domain, reducing the risk of phishing attacks on your recipients. This establishes your brand as a trustworthy sender and safeguards your email campaigns.
Preventing Email Spoofing
Prevent email spoofing and ensure the security of your email campaigns by implementing SPF and DKIM to authenticate your emails.
Email spoofing is a common technique used by attackers to send emails that appear to come from a trusted source, but are actually malicious.
SPF (Sender Policy Framework) and DKIM (DomainKeys Identified Mail) are email authentication methods that help prevent email spoofing and protect the integrity of your email campaigns.
SPF verifies that the sender's IP address is authorized to send emails on behalf of a particular domain.
DKIM uses encryption to verify that the email content hasn't been tampered with during transit.
Frequently Asked Questions
Can SPF and DKIM Prevent All Types of Email Threats?
Yes, SPF and DKIM are effective email authentication methods that can greatly reduce the risk of various email threats. Implementing these best practices is crucial for ensuring the security of your email campaigns.
What Are Some Common Challenges When Setting up SPF for a Domain?
Setting up SPF for a domain can present common challenges. Troubleshooting tips include checking for syntax errors, ensuring DNS records are correct, and testing with SPF validation tools.
How Can I Check if My SPF and DKIM Records Are Correctly Configured?
To troubleshoot your SPF and DKIM configuration, it's important to regularly check your records. Use online tools like MX Toolbox or DMARC Analyzer to verify if everything is correctly set up.
Is It Possible for SPF and DKIM to Negatively Impact Email Deliverability?
Yes, it's possible for SPF and DKIM to have potential drawbacks on email deliverability if not properly configured. Following best practices in setting up and maintaining these protocols will help ensure optimal deliverability.
Are There Any Alternatives to SPF and DKIM for Securing Email Campaigns?
There are no direct alternatives to SPF and DKIM for securing email campaigns. However, implementing SPF and DKIM provides numerous benefits such as improved deliverability, reduced spam, and increased trustworthiness of your emails.
Conclusion
In conclusion, implementing SPF and DKIM protocols is crucial for safeguarding your email campaigns.
SPF helps verify the authenticity of the sending domain, while DKIM ensures the integrity of the email content.
By following the step-by-step guide and best practices mentioned in this article, you can protect your email reputation and prevent unauthorized use of your domain.
Continuously monitoring and troubleshooting any issues will help maintain the effectiveness of SPF and DKIM.
Future-proof your email campaigns by implementing these essential security measures today.